Cryo-EM structures of infectious bursal disease viruses with different virulences provide insights into their assembly and invasion
13 Dec 2021
Abstract excerpt
Infectious bursal disease virus (IBDV) causes a highly contagious immunosuppressive disease in chickens, resulting in significant economic losses. The very virulent IBDV strain (vvIBDV) causes high mortality and cannot adapt to cell culture. In contrast, attenuated strains of IBDV are nonpathogenic to chickens and can replicate in cell culture.
